## Onboarding: Farebranch Rules Engine

Plugin authors integrate with Farebranch by registering fee rules against the evaluation API. Rules are sandboxed; they cannot perform network calls directly. All rate-table lookups go through the host, which validates your plugin manifest at load time. Your local env file must include the signing credential the host uses to verify manifests, set on the next line.

secret setting of bajef-fajof: COURIER_KEY3=76c

Subject: Intern cohort arriving Monday — access prep

Hello Facilities,

The spring intern cohort for the Lanthorn programme arrives Monday at 9am, twelve people in total. Front desk will handle sign-in and lanyards, but we need the third-floor project room and the bike store enabled for them by Friday. Their individual badges will be printed during induction, so for the first morning they will move as a group with a supervisor using a shared temporary pass, detailed below.

turnstile pass: bdg-QZV-3

Subject: Key rotation — Pinmark autocomplete

Team, we rotated the service key for the Pinmark address autocomplete widget this morning. The old key stops working Friday at noon. Update the widget config in staging first, then production, and flag any PRs still referencing the old value. The replacement key is below.

API key for yahig-tadup: kto7_ubizbYm